Senior Revenue Accountant at Abnormal AI is responsible for owning key aspects of the revenue close process, including preparing and reviewing audit-ready reconciliations, workpapers, journal entries, and analyses to support monthly close, financial reporting, and external audits. This role partners with Deal Desk, FP&A, Legal, and other teams to resolve operational issues and improve upstream processes, focusing on standardization, controls, and automation through AI-enabled workflows. Must Haves: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field; 4+ years of progressive accounting, audit, or related finance experience; str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P with revenue recognition experience; demonstrated history owning or leading recurring close activities, reconciliations, and financial analyses in a fast-paced environment; strong analytical skills and attention to detail; advanced Excel skills including reconciliations, lookups, and large data analyses. Nice to Have: ASC 606 and ASC 340-40 experience in a SaaS revenue accounting environment; experience at a Big Four firm, a high-growth pre-IPO company, or a publicly traded technology company; experience with ERP, billing, and close-management systems such as NetSuite, Salesforce, Maxio, or FloQast; CPA license or active progress toward CPA and interest in leveraging AI and automation to improve accounting processes. Base salary range: $95,600—$137,500 USD. This role may be eligible for bonus or incentive compensation, equity, and a comprehensive benefits package.
